/*PROGETTO BORSA DEL VINO PEGASO 2000*/

/*
##########################################
STILI DI TESTO
#########################################
*/
DIV.bold { font-size:12px; 
           font-family: Arial;
           font-weight:bold;
           text-align:justify;
           color:black; }
DIV.normale, DIV.NORMALE { font-size:12px;
              font-family:Arial;
              color:black;
              text-align:justify; }
DIV.rosso, DIV.Rosso { font-size:12px;
            font-family:Arial;
            font-weight:bold;
            text-align:justify;
            color:red; }
            
span.menuBanda
{
	font-family: verdana;
	font-size: 9px;
	color:#FFFFFF;
	text-decoration:none;	
}

.menuBanda:LINK, a.menuBanda:ACTIVE, a.menuBanda:VISITED
{
	font-family: verdana;
	font-size: 9px;
	color:#FFFFFF;
	text-decoration:none;	
}

div.titoloBachecaArticoli
{
	font-family: verdana;
	font-size: 12px;
	color:#000000;
	font-weight:bold;
	text-indent: 4px;
	text-align:left;
}

div.bachecaNews
{
	font-family: verdana;
	font-size: 12px;
	color:#FFFFFF;
	font-weight:bold;
	text-indent: 4px;
}

.datagridtable
{
	/*vertical-align: top;
	width: 90%;
	cursor: default;
	background-color: #ffffff;
	text-align: left;*/
	background-color: #670001;
	font-family: verdana;
	font-size: 12px;
	color:#FFFFFF;
	font-weight:bold;
	text-align: center;
}

.nickname
{
	font-family: Verdana, Arial, Helvetica, sans-serif; 
	font-size: 10px;
	text-align:center;
	text-indent:6px;
	vertical-align:middle;
	color: #FFFFFF;
}

.titletab
{
	/*font-family: Verdana, Arial, Helvetica, sans-serif; 
	font-size: 11px;
	text-align:center; 
	color: #FFFFFF; 
	background-color: #cd3232;*/
	/*background-color: #670001;*/
	background-color:  #ce0004;
	font-family: verdana;
	font-size: 12px;
	color:#FFFFFF;
	font-weight:bold;
	text-align: center;
	
}
.titletabs
{
	font-family: Verdana, Arial, Helvetica, sans-serif; 
	font-size: 11px;
	text-align:center;
	text-decoration:underline;
	color: #FFFFFF; 
	background-color:#cd3232;
}
.rowtab1
{
	/*font-family: Verdana, Arial, Helvetica, sans-serif; 
	font-size: 11px; 
	text-align: left;
	color: #646464; 
	background-color: #C0EAC9;*/
	background-color: #ffcbcd;
	font-family: verdana;
	font-size: 10px;
	color:#000000;
	text-align: center;	
}
.rowtab2
{
	/*font-family: Verdana, Arial, Helvetica, sans-serif; 
	font-size: 11px; 
	text-align: left;
	color: #646464; 
	background-color: #D7FFDF;*/
	
	background-color: #cccccc;
	font-family: verdana;
	font-size: 10px;
	color:#000000;
	text-align: center;		
}

.testo
{
	font-family: verdana;
	font-size: 10px;
	color:#000000;
	text-indent: 0px;
}

.testoMax
{
	font-family: verdana;
	font-size: 12px;
	color:#000000;
	text-indent: 0px;
}
.testoBold
{
	font-family: verdana;
	font-size: 12px;
	color:#000000;
	text-indent: 0px;
}


div.testoGrigio
{
	font-family: verdana;
	font-size: 10px;
	color:#676767;
	text-indent: 0px;
}

div.testoGrande
{
	font-family: verdana;
	font-size: 13px;
	color:#000000;
	text-align:justify;
}

.testoGrande
{
	font-family: verdana;
	font-size: 13px;
	color:#000000;
	text-align:justify;
}

div.testoGrandeBold
{
	font-family: verdana;
	font-size: 13px;
	color:#000000;
	text-align:justify;
	font-weight:bold;
}

.testoGrandeBold
{
	font-family: verdana;
	font-size: 13px;
	color:#000000;
	text-align:justify;
	font-weight:bold;
}

div.testoTitoloTesta
{
	font-family: verdana;
	font-size: 13px;
	color:Green;
	text-align:justify;
}

div.testoTitoloDataGrid
{
	font-family: verdana;
	font-size: 13px;
	color:Green;
	text-align:justify;
}

.errorMessage
{
	color:#f00001;
	font-family: verdana;
	font-size: 12px;
	font-weight:bold; 
	border-width:1px;
	border-color:#f00001;
	border-style:solid;
	border-collapse:collapse;
	padding: 0 0 0 8px;
}

.infoMessage
{
	color:#009900;
	font-family: verdana;
	font-size: 12px;
	font-weight:bold; 
	border-width:1px;
	border-color:#009900;
	border-style:solid;
	border-collapse:collapse;
	padding: 0 0 0 8px;
}

span.testoCampoObbligatorio
{
	font-family: verdana;
	font-size: 10px;
	color:#f00001;
	text-indent: 0px;
}

.footer, a.footer:LINK
{
	font-family: verdana;
	font-size: 9px;
	color:#FFFFFF;
	text-decoration:none;	
}

a.footer:HOVER
{
	font-family: verdana;
	font-size: 9px;
	color:#000000;
	text-decoration:none;
}

.paginazione
{
    width: 10%;
    COLOR: #000000;
    FONT-WEIGHT: normal;
    FONT-SIZE: 11px;
    VERTICAL-ALIGN: top;
    FONT-FAMILY: Verdana;
    padding-bottom: 5px;
    text-align:center;
}

/*
##########################################
STILI LINK 88 66
#########################################
*/

a:LINK
{
	color:#A00000;
}

a:VISITED
{
	color:#660000;
}


a.menuBanda:LINK, a.menuBanda:ACTIVE, a.menuBanda:VISITED
{
	font-family: verdana;
	font-size: 9px;
	color:#FFFFFF;
	text-decoration:none;	
}

a.menuAlto:LINK, a.menuAlto:ACTIVE, a.menuAlto:VISITED
{
	font-family: verdana;
	font-size: 10px;
	color:#FFFFFF;
	text-decoration:none;	
}

a.menuAlto:HOVER
{
	font-family: verdana;
	font-size: 10px;
	color:#000000;
	text-decoration:none;
}

a.menuSx:LINK, a.menuSx:ACTIVE, a.menuSx:VISITED
{
	font-family: verdana;
	font-weight: bold;
	font-size: 11px;
	vertical-align: middle;
	text-align: center;
	color: #FFFFFF;
	text-decoration: none;
	display: block;
	text-indent: 8px; 
	background: URL(  '../Images/menu_sx_hover_unactive.gif' );
	border-right: 0px solid;
	border-top: 0px solid;
	border-left: 0px solid;
	border-bottom: 0px solid;
}

a.menuSx:HOVER
{
	font-family: verdana;
	font-weight: bold;
	font-size: 11px;
	vertical-align: middle;
	text-align: center;
	color: #FFFFFF;
	text-decoration: none;
	display: block;
	/*width: 166px;*/
	/*height: 27px;*/
	text-indent: 8px; 
	background: URL( '../Images/menu_sx_hover_active.jpg' );
	border-right: 0px solid;
	border-top: 0px solid;
	border-left: 0px solid;
	border-bottom: 0px solid;
}


a.testoArticoli:LINK, a.testoArticoli:ACTIVE, a.testoArticoli:VISITED
{
	font-family: verdana;
	font-size: 11px;
	color:#000000;
	text-decoration:none;
}

a.testoArticoli:HOVER
{
	font-family: verdana;
	font-size: 11px;
	color:#999999;
	text-decoration:none;
}

a.testo:LINK, a.testo:ACTIVE, a.testo:VISITED
{
	font-family: verdana;
	font-size: 11px;
	font-weight:bold;
	text-align:left;
	text-indent:6px;
	color:#000000;
	text-decoration:none;
}

a.testo:HOVER
{
	font-family: verdana;
	font-size: 11px;
	font-weight:bold;
	text-align:left;
	text-indent:6px;
	color:#999999;
	text-decoration:underline;
}

a.LinkMenuAmministrazine:LINK, a.LinkMenuAmministrazine:ACTIVE, a.LinkMenuAmministrazine:VISITED
{
	font-family: verdana;
	font-size: 11px;
	font-weight: bold;
	color: #A00000;
}

a.LinkMenuAmministrazine:HOVER
{
	font-family: verdana;
	font-size: 11px;
	font-weight:bold;
	color:#999999;
}

td.CellaMenuAmministrazione
{
	vertical-align: middle;
}

/*
##########################################
STILI TABELLA
#########################################
*/

.pager1
{
	/*background-color: #B88B8B;*/
	background-color: #ce0004;
}

td.menuSxSeparatore
{
	background-color: #47691a;
	height: 1px;
	border-right: 0px solid;
	padding-right: 0px;
	border-top: 0px solid;
	padding-left: 0px;
	padding-bottom: 0px;
	margin: 0px;
	border-left: 0px solid;
	padding-top: 0px;
	border-bottom: 0px solid;
}

td.menuSxBottoni
{
	width: 194px;
	height: 27px;
	text-align: center;
	vertical-align: middle;
	border-right: 0px solid;
	padding-right: 0px;
	border-top: 0px solid;
	padding-left: 0px;
	padding-bottom: 0px;
	margin: 0px;
	border-left: 0px solid;
	padding-top: 0px;
	border-bottom: 0px solid;
	background-image: url(../Images/menu_sx_hover_unactive.gif);
	background-color: transparent;
}

td.tabellaBorsaHeader
{
	background-color: #670001;
	font-family: verdana;
	font-size: 12px;
	color:#FFFFFF;
	font-weight:bold;
	text-align: center;
}

td.tabellaBorsaGrigio
{
	background-color: #cccccc;
	font-family: verdana;
	font-size: 10px;
	color:#000000;
	text-align: center;
}

td.tabellaBorsaRosa
{
	background-color: #ffcbcd;
	font-family: verdana;
	font-size: 10px;
	color:#000000;
	text-align: center;
}

td.tabellaAsteHeader
{
	background-color: #ff9900;
	font-family: verdana;
	font-size: 12px;
	color:#FFFFFF;
	font-weight:bold;
	text-align: center;
}

td.tabellaAsteGrigio
{
	background-color: #FEDCC7;
	font-family: verdana;
	font-size: 10px;
	color:#000000;
	text-align: center;
}

td.tabellaAsteGrigioOld
{
	background-color: #e5e5e5;
	font-family: verdana;
	font-size: 10px;
	color:#000000;
	text-align: center;
}
td.tabellaAsteGiallo
{
	background-color: #FEFDDE;
	font-family: verdana;
	font-size: 10px;
	color:#000000;
	text-align: center;
}

td.tabellaAsteGialloOld
{
	background-color: #ffffcd;
	font-family: verdana;
	font-size: 10px;
	color:#000000;
	text-align: center;
}
.datagridAsteHeader
{
	/*background-color: #ff9900;*/
	background-color: #ff9966;	
	font-family: verdana;
	font-size: 12px;
	color:#FFFFFF;
	font-weight:bold;
	text-align: center;
}

.datagridAsteGrigio
{
	/*background-color: #FEDCC7;*/
	background-color: #ffffcc;
	font-family: verdana;
	font-size: 10px;
	color:#000000;
	text-align: center;
}

.datagridAsteGiallo
{
	/*background-color: #fefdde;*/
	background-color: #efd6c6;
	font-family: verdana;
	font-size: 10px;
	color:#000000;
	text-align: center;
}

.datagridAsteGrigioOld
{
	background-color: #e5e5e5;
	font-family: verdana;
	font-size: 10px;
	color:#000000;
	text-align: center;
}

.datagridAsteGialloOld
{
	background-color: #ffffcd;
	font-family: verdana;
	font-size: 10px;
	color:#000000;
	text-align: center;
}

.datagridBorsaHeader
{
	/*background-color: #670001;*/
	background-color: #ce0004;
	font-family: verdana;
	font-size: 12px;
	color:#FFFFFF;
	font-weight:bold;
	text-align: center;
}

.datagridBorsaGrigio
{
	background-color: #ebdac2;
	font-family: verdana;
	font-size: 10px;
	color:#000000;
	text-align: center;
}

.datagridBorsaRosa
{
	background-color: #fedcc7;
	font-family: verdana;
	font-size: 10px;
	color:#000000;
	text-align: center;
}

.datagridBorsaGrigioOld
{
	background-color: #cccccc;
	font-family: verdana;
	font-size: 10px;
	color:#000000;
	text-align: center;
}

.datagridBorsaRosaOld
{
	background-color: #ffcbcd;
	font-family: verdana;
	font-size: 10px;
	color:#000000;
	text-align: center;
}

/*
##########################################
STILI DI FORM
#########################################
*/
textarea.messaggiHelp
{
	font-family: verdana;
	font-size: 10px;
	color: #000000;
	padding: 2px;
	border: 1px solid #000000;
	background-color: #FFFFF0;
	overflow:hidden;
}

select
{
	font-family: verdana;
	font-size: 12px;
	color:#000000;
	border: 1px solid #000000;
}

.inputText
{
	font-family: verdana;
	font-size: 11px;	
	color:#000000;
	border: 1px solid #000000;
}

.inputAllegati
{
	font-family: verdana;
	font-size: 12px;
	color:#000000;
	border: 0px;
	background-color: #ffffff;
	overflow:hidden;
	margin: 0px;
	padding: 0px;
}
.inputButton
{
	background-color: #FFCD93; 
	font-family: verdana;
	font-size: 10px;
	text-align: center;
	color:#000000;
	border: 1px doubled #000000;
}

.bottoneMarrone
{ 
   width: 110px;
   height: 24px;
   border: 0;
   background-image: url('../Images/btn_marrone.jpg');
   cursor: pointer;
   font-family: verdana;
   font-size: 10px;
   color:#FFFFFF;
   font-weight:bold;
   font-style: italic;
}


.bottoneRob
{  
   border: 0;
   width:65px;
   height:15px;
   background-image: url('../Images/btn_rob.gif');
   cursor: pointer;
   font-family: verdana;
   font-size: 9px;
   color:#775384;
   font-weight:bold;
   font-style: italic;
}

.bottoneRobLungo
{  
   border: 0;
   width:77px;
   height:15px;
   background-image: url('../Images/btn_rob_lunga.gif');
   cursor: pointer;
   font-family: verdana;
   font-size: 9px;
   color:#775384;
   font-weight:bold;
   font-style: italic;
}

.bottoneRobMonitoraggio
{  
   border: 0;
   width:150px;
   height:15px;
   background-image: url('../Images/btn_rob_monitoraggio.gif');
   cursor: pointer;
   font-family: verdana;
   font-size: 9px;
   color:#775384;
   font-weight:bold;
   font-style: italic;
}

.bottoneRosso 
{
   font-size: 9px;
   width: 50px;
   height: 24px;
   border: 0;
   background-image: url('../Images/btn_rosso.jpg');
   cursor: pointer;
   font-family: verdana;
   font-size: 10px;
   font-weight:bold;
   color:#FFFFFF;
}

.bottoneVaiProdotto
{
   font-size: 9px;
   width: 100px;
   height: 24px;
   border: 0;
   background-image: url('../Images/btn_vai_prodotto.jpg');
   cursor: pointer;
   font-family: verdana;
   font-size: 10px;
   font-weight:bold;
   color:#FFFFFF;
}

.bottoneVaiProdottoMax
{
   font-size: 9px;
   width: 150px;
   height: 24px;
   border: 0;
   background-image: url('../Images/btn_vai_prodotto.jpg');
   cursor: pointer;
   font-family: verdana;
   font-size: 10px;
   font-weight:bold;
   color:#FFFFFF;
}


/*FINE PROGETTO BORSA DEL VINO PEGASO 2000*/

